Regulatory Authorities Slow to Act While Crypto Industry Awaits Clear Guidelines

- SEC delays Truth Social's Bitcoin ETF decision beyond standard 60-day review, raising regulatory strategy questions. - Application serves as test case for crypto investment vehicles, with implications for security vs. commodity classification. - Critics argue prolonged delays stifle innovation, while market awaits clarity on SEC-CFTC regulatory alignment. - Mixed market reaction persists as investors hold off major crypto moves until regulatory framework becomes clearer.

The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has postponed its verdict yet again regarding the proposed

exchange-traded fund (ETF) submission from Truth Social, a decision that has reignited discussions among both investors and analysts. This recent move by the SEC extends the review process for the application well beyond the typical 60-day window, joining an expanding roster of delayed judgments on cryptocurrency investment products. The prolonged evaluation period has prompted fresh scrutiny of the SEC’s methods for overseeing crypto assets and its overall approach to adapting to the rapidly changing digital asset landscape.

Truth Social’s bid for a Bitcoin ETF is among several awaiting the SEC’s determination and is viewed as a bellwether for how the regulator might respond to future crypto-based investment funds. The company has highlighted the ETF’s potential to provide institutional-level access to Bitcoin for a wider range of investors, especially those hesitant about holding cryptocurrencies directly. The continued postponements by the SEC are seen by some as an indication of ongoing internal debate over whether Bitcoin should be categorized as a security or a commodity. Market experts point out that the final decision could establish a benchmark for subsequent applications and help shape the regulatory landscape for digital assets in general.

The SEC’s repeated delays have drawn criticism from lawmakers and industry leaders who contend that the slow pace is hindering innovation and causing investment capital to move abroad. Some members of Congress have demanded more openness about the agency’s decision-making and have pressed for clearer regulatory direction regarding crypto assets. At the same time, market watchers continue to speculate about the possible consequences of the SEC’s eventual decision, closely monitoring any indications of alignment or divergence with the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C).

Recent remarks from the SEC emphasize a commitment to safeguarding investors and maintaining the integrity of financial markets, but the agency has not specified when it will decide on the Truth Social application or similar proposals. The SEC has also remained reserved in its public comments regarding Bitcoin, steering clear of definitive statements that could suggest approval or rejection of the asset class. This cautious stance has led some analysts to believe that the delays are a tactical effort to avoid appearing to officially endorse or legitimize the expanding crypto sector until a comprehensive regulatory framework is established.

The market’s response to the SEC’s latest delay has been varied, with Bitcoin’s price showing little immediate reaction to the news. While some analysts argue that investors have already anticipated another extension, others think that a favorable decision could spark a notable price surge. The ongoing ambiguity surrounding the SEC’s ruling continues to influence investor attitudes, with many participants waiting for regulatory certainty before making major moves in the cryptocurrency market.
